France has suspended military cooperation with the new government of Gabon


French Defense Minister Sebastien Lecornu said the Paris government has suspended military cooperation with the new government of Gabon.


This is coming at the same time that the President of the country, General Brice Oligui Nguema, has vowed that the country's authorities will be democratic, two days after the coup that ended the 55-year rule of the Bongo family.


The country has about 400 soldiers in Gabon who are training the country's army.


France condemned the coup d'état in Gabon on Wednesday and reiterated its intention to respect the results of the presidential election held last Saturday in the western country. Africa.




Five countries on the African continent including Mali, Guinea, Sudan, Burkina Faso and Niger have experienced coups in the past three years.
